Food Establishments - Lavatory Requirement and On-Farm Food Service Facility License

Sponsor: Chair, Health CommitteeCommittee: HealthSubject: Public HealthStatus: Approved by the Governor - Chapter 189 (as of Sep 4, 2026)

What this bill does

Official synopsis

Altering the type of toilet that certain food establishments may use to comply with the requirement to provide a convenient lavatory; requiring that the fee for an on-farm food service facility license be determined by the Maryland Department of Health based on certain factors and prohibiting the fee from exceeding $100; establishing a 1-year term for an on-farm service facility license; and requiring the Department, in consultation with other departments and stakeholders, to adopt regulations governing on-farm service facility licenses.
